Whispers of Nature and Tradition: Unveil the Hidden Charms of Castel di Sangro
Nestled in the heart of Italy's Abruzzo region, Castel di Sangro is a charming small town that captures the essence of the Italian countryside. Surrounded by majestic mountains and lush natural parks, it invites travelers to explore breathtaking landscapes and indulge in outdoor adventures like hiking and skiing. Stroll through its historic streets, where medieval architecture meets inviting local cafes, offering delectable regional cuisine. Just a short drive away, the enchanting towns of Roccaraso and Sulmona await, making Castel di Sangro the perfect base for those seeking a blend of culture, nature, and authentic Italian charm. For the best hotel rates in Castel di Sangro and to enhance your stay, be sure to check out Hotels.com's Last-Minute DealsOpens in a new window on travel.